HANLEY, James. Resurrexit Dominus. LIMITED FIRST EDITION FROM THE PUBLISHER'S OWN LIBRARY. 1934 Privately Printed [By Boriswood though not stated] Limited to 110 copies Signed and Numbered by Hanley on limitation page. This being number 4 being from the Publisher's own library and bought by us from the grand-daughter of the original publishers. Large 8vo. Bound in vellum with leather lettering piece. Top edge gilt, others deckled (uncut). A Fine copy in the original acetate wrapper. Loosely inserted are some 'obscene' passages typed onto two pieces of paper with page references probably used by the family for the court case that was running at this time over "Boy". See notes below. Undoubtedly the scarcest of Hanley's books, private published by his trade publisher, Boriswood, who held the manuscript for three years because of its controversial subject matter (the rape of a 14-year-old girl by a priest). During this period Hanley and Boriswood were being sued in connection with the publication of "Boy", which suit they lost. The publishers Boriswood were advised that, owing to the book's reference to 'intimacy between members of the male sex', any defence against prosecution was futile. In March 1935 Boriswood pleaded guilty of "uttering and publishing an obscene libel" and paid a substantial fine. While Resurrexit Dominus was not officially suppressed, as was "Boy", copies of the book were, generally, not available. The title still remains out of print. Gibbs A11a. 71210

HANLEY, James. The German Prisoner. With an Introduction by Richard Aldington. PRIVATELY PRINTED BY THE AUTHOR & LIMITED TO 500 SIGNED COPIES. [1930] Privately printed by the author. Muswell Hill. London. [1930] Introduced by Richard Aldington.No DW. LIMITED EDITION OF 500 COPIES ONLY, SIGNED BY AUTHOR, this being number 493. Top edge gilt. Woodcut frontis. by William Roberts. One of the lost classics of World War One which paints a vile portrait of what really happens in war and is one of the darkest, bleakest and most horrific stories of trench warfare I have read. Slim 8vo. Original maroon buckram gilt, slightly rubbed to boards, two small star stickers to tail of spine. Pages browned. Contains loose newspaper reviews of Hanley's works. A very clean and sound copy of one of the scarcest items of fiction based on a first hand experience of WWI. 77235
